How excretory system works?

The excretory system is responsible for the elimination of waste products from the body and the maintenance of proper fluid and electrolyte balance. It consists of several organs and structures, including the kidneys, ureters, bladder, and urethra.

The process begins in the kidneys, which are bean-shaped organs located in the back of the abdomen. Blood enters the kidneys through the renal arteries, and within each kidney, it passes through tiny filtering units called nephrons. Nephrons filter waste products, excess water, and electrolytes from the blood, producing a fluid called filtrate.

As the filtrate passes through the nephrons, essential substances such as glucose, amino acids, and certain ions are reabsorbed back into the bloodstream. This reabsorption occurs in specialized tubules within the nephrons.

2. A homozygous dominant genotype is when an individual has two copies of the same dominant allele for a specific gene. In genetic notation, it is represented by two capital letters, such as "AA". This individual will express the dominant trait because the dominant allele masks the effect of the recessive allele.

A homozygous recessive genotype is when an individual has two copies of the same recessive allele for a specific gene. In genetic notation, it is represented by two lowercase letters, such as "aa". This individual will express the recessive trait because there is no dominant allele to mask its effect.

3. A heterozygous genotype is when an individual has two different alleles for a specific gene, one dominant and one recessive. In genetic notation, it is represented by one capital letter and one lowercase letter, with the capital letter representing the dominant allele and the lowercase letter representing the recessive allele. For example, "Aa" is a heterozygous genotype, where "A" is the dominant allele and "a" is the recessive allele.

This pyramid, "the castle," is just one part of a large archaeological site that was a major city almost fifteen hundred years ago. It is believed that two groups of people, the Mayans and the Toltecs, called this city their home. The city included a marketplace, a plaza, a church, and an observatory, as well as a ball court, a temple for sacrifices, and a sinkhole which provided water for the people. The pyramid has four sides, each with ninety-one stairs; the four sets of stairs combine with the platform at the top to equal 365 three hundred sixty-five stairs-one for each day of the year. In addition, at sunrise and sunset on the spring and autumn equinoxes, the sun casts the shadow of a serpent moving down the pyramid toward the sinkhole. The observatory, used to study the sun, moon, and stars, provides further evidence of the Mayans' and Toltecs' interest in astronomy. Today this former city is one of the most popular in this south of the border country, seeing almost three million visitors each year.
